How should you craft your dating profile to get the best matches?
Talk about things you value, Kociuba suggests.
Instead of saying that you like to go hiking, explain why you like hiking.
Do you like the peace and solitude of being in nature?
Do you like hiking for the health benefits?
People forget to put the meaning and passion behind what they like to do, Kociuba says.
